Dilations- (Geometry)?

Question # 1: What coordinates represent of point (0,-3) under a dilation center (-2,-4) and scale factor of 3?

A) (4,-1)

B) (0,-9)

C) (-6,-6)

D) (-6, -12)

Question # 2: Triangle K' L' M' is a dilation of KLM with scale factor 2 and the center if dilation at (1,1) What are the coordinates of K' L' M' ? K (-1,3) L' (1,-1), M' (3,5)

A) K' (-3,5) L' (1,-3), M' (5,9)

B) K' (-2,6), L' (2,-2), M' (6,10)

C) K' (O,2), L' (1,0), M' (2,3)

D) K' (1,5), L' (3,1), M' (5,7)

    1. From the center (-2,-4) to (0,-3), a segment would go right 2 and up 1. Scaling by 3 changes it to right 6 and up 3 from the center. The new point is (4, -1).

    2. Same thing, just do it for three points.

    (1, 1) to K: left 2, up 2. Scale of 2 makes it left 4, up 4. K' is (-3, 5). The answer has to be A.
